#c58b5f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c58b5f is composed of 77.3% red, 54.5%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.4% magenta, 51.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 25.9 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 57.3%. #c58b5f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be with #8b1700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c58b5f color description : Moderate orange.

#c58b5f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c58b5f has RGB values of R:197, G:139,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.52,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12946271.

Shades and Tints of #c58b5f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0805 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
